Longmeadow, MA - September 15, 2025 - The Alzheimer’s Association Massachusetts/New Hampshire Chapter will host the Pioneer Valley Walk to End Alzheimer’s Kickoff Event on Wednesday, September 17, 2025, at the Leavitt Family Jewish Home, 770 Converse Street, Longmeadow, MA. The event, titled Impact of Dementia Across Pioneer Valley, will bring together community members, advocates, and leaders for a morning of conversation and learning about the effects of dementia in the region. Event Details: ● Registration: 8:00 AM (light breakfast provided by JGS Lifecare) ● Panel Discussion: 8:30–9:30 AM, moderated by Beth Cardillo ● Special Guest: Senator Jake Oliveira ● Panelists: Grace Barone (ERC5), Sean Terwilliger (Early Stage Advocate), Meghan Lemay (Alzheimer’s Association) The panel will highlight the personal, social, and economic impact of dementia in Pioneer Valley while exploring how individuals and organizations can take action to support families, raise awareness, and help end Alzheimer’s disease. The Walk to End Alzheimer’s Pioneer Valley will take place on Sunday, October 26, 2025, at Holyoke Community College. Funds raised through the Walk fuel the Association’s mission of providing free care and support services, advocating for policies that advance dementia research, and funding global studies aimed at treatment and prevention.
